BLACK STAR TELEVISION (GHANA) LIMITED vs. GHANA TELECOMMUNICATIONS CO. LTD
SOWAH JA On 21st December 2007, the plaintiff/appellant [hereafter referred to as the plaintiff] entered into a written agreement with the defendant/respondent/cross-petitioner [hereafter referred to as the defendant] whereby they agreed to collaborate to provide digital mobile television services to the public on the defendants GT/OneTouch network through terrestrial digital multimedia broadcasting device (T-DMB). Revenue was to be generated from the sale of the device and monthly subscription by customers of the defendants OneTouch network, and was to be shared in a ratio of 90% to plaintiff and 10% to the defendant. Prior to the execution of the contract, the defendant is alleged to have demonstrated its commitment to the project by paying the commitment fee of US$300,000 and securing exclusivity rights for one year from the commercial launch.
